How to Build a Real Directory Website on Wix (Beyond Templates)

The three templates above give you a solid visual starting point, but they are travel-themed designs - not true business directories. A real directory (think restaurant finder, local services guide, or professional listings site) needs data storage, search, and filtering. That is where Wix CMS comes in. Here is how to set it up.

Step 1: Create a CMS Collection Called "Listings"

In the Wix Editor, open the CMS panel and create a new Collection named "Listings." Add the following fields to cover typical directory needs:

  • Business Name (Text)
  • Category (Text or Reference)
  • Address (Text)
  • Phone (Text)
  • Description (Long Text)
  • Rating (Number)
  • Website URL (URL)
  • Featured Image (Image)

You can add or remove fields based on your niche. A restaurant directory might include "Cuisine Type" and "Price Range," while a contractor directory might include "License Number" and "Service Area."

Step 2: Add a Dynamic List Page

Once your collection has data, create a Dynamic List Page connected to it. This page automatically generates one card or row per listing. Arrange the layout using Wix's grid or repeater element so visitors can scan multiple entries at once. Connect each element (name, address, image) to the matching CMS field using the data binding panel.

Step 3: Add Search and Filter with Wix Pro Search

Install the Wix Pro Search app from the Wix App Market. This gives you a search bar that queries your CMS collection in real time. You can also add filter widgets that let visitors narrow results by category, location, or any other field you set. For a local services directory, a "Category" filter alone can dramatically improve how useful the site feels to visitors.

Step 4: Add Apps for Listing Submissions and Monetization

Three Wix apps make a directory significantly more powerful:

  • Wix Members - Lets users register and submit their own listings through a form. The submission goes into a CMS draft state so you can review before publishing. This is essential for any community-driven wix business directory template.
  • Wix Pricing Plans - Charge for featured or premium listings. You can gate certain listing tiers (e.g., "Basic," "Featured," "Top Placement") behind a payment wall.
  • Google Maps element - Add a map to any listing's detail page so visitors can see exactly where a business is located. For location-based directories, this is one of the most-used features.

How Long Does This Take?

A basic CMS-powered directory on Wix - with a collection, dynamic list page, and search bar - takes about 3 to 5 hours to set up if you are comfortable with Wix Editor. Adding member submissions and paid tiers adds another 2 to 3 hours. The payoff is a site that actually functions as a directory rather than a static page with listed entries.

When Wix Beats a Dedicated Directory Platform

Third-party directory platforms (like Brilliant Directories or DirectoryEngine) handle more volume and offer deeper directory-specific features out of the box. But Wix wins on cost, design control, and ease of use when:

  • You are starting with fewer than 500 listings
  • You want full design control without custom code
  • Your directory is one section of a larger site (e.g., a city blog with a business directory attached)
  • Budget is limited and you do not want to pay for a specialized platform

For most small and medium directories, the Wix CMS approach works well and keeps everything in one place.

A Brief History of Online Directories

Directories started as printed books - phone directories, business yellow pages, classified listings. Moving them online changed who could access them and how often they could be updated, but the core idea stayed the same: a structured, searchable list of things people want to find.

1990s

The internet launched, and with it came Yahoo! Directory, a curated list organized by human editors. It felt like a library card catalog for the web.

Early 2000s

Craigslist emerged as a no-frills classifieds and directory hybrid that became a phenomenon despite (or because of) its minimalist design.

Mid-2000s

Facebook began as a directory for college students, letting people find and connect with classmates. That feature set expanded into something far larger.

2010s

Airbnb built a lodging directory that added trust signals, user reviews, and verified photos - turning a basic listing format into a global marketplace.

Now

Modern directories compete on user experience, data freshness, and mobile usability. The right wix directory template and CMS setup can get a small or niche directory online quickly, without the overhead of a custom-built platform.

Yes, Wix supports searchable directories through a combination of Wix CMS and the Wix Pro Search app. You create a CMS Collection to store your listings (with fields like Business Name, Category, Address, and Description), connect it to a Dynamic List page, and then install Wix Pro Search from the App Market to add a real-time search bar. You can also add filter widgets that let visitors narrow results by category or location. This approach works well for directories with up to a few hundred listings and gives you full control over the design through the Wix Editor.
